Mary Ellen Jennings Helgemo

Mary Ellen Jennings Helgemo, sadly, left us on September 25 to be with God and so many loved ones. Mary was born on September 14, 1927 in Flint Michigan to Margaret Pelton and Trace Jennings.

She married Richard Helgemo in 1947 and had three children, Richard, Janice and Dorothy. Richard and Mary left Downey in 1971 and retired to Bonsall. Mary was a founding member of the Bonsall Women's Club.

A few years after Richard's death in 1990, Mary moved to Rancho Monserate. She was the first female president and held other positions on the board of directors. She also was a volunteer for many years at Fallbrook Hospital.

Mary was an amazing mother, grandmother, aunt and friend to all who knew her. She was selfless and would do anything for anyone…and did. Recognition wasn’t important to her. Random acts of kindness and generosity were her nature. She was a true patriot and loved dogs.

She passed at home and her family was with her. As difficult as it is not to have her physical presence, we know her work here on earth was done. Rest in peace, Mary, the world was a much better place with you in it.

Mary's survivors are her children, Richard Helgemo (Gerry), Jan Carver and Dorothy Eck (Dave); her four grandchildren, Randy (Cyndi), Eric (Christine), Gina (Eric), Lea (Rudy); eight great-grandchildren, Alexis (Will), Megan, Nathan, Will, Becca, David, Wyatt, and Ryder and one great-great-grandson, Kaleb.

A celebration of life will be held in Fallbrook at 1 p.m., Saturday, October 14 at Rancho Monserate, 4650 Dulin Road. In lieu of flowers, the family prefers a donation to Patriotic Service Dog Foundation in memory of Mary.
